rows_reoredered patch not yet in GTK
svn: r20833
This commit is contained in:
@@ -620,7 +620,9 @@ class ListView(NavigationView):
|
|||||||
filter_info = (False, value, value[0] in self.exact_search())
|
filter_info = (False, value, value[0] in self.exact_search())
|
||||||
|
|
||||||
if same_col:
|
if same_col:
|
||||||
if (Gtk.get_major_version(), Gtk.get_minor_version()) >= (3,8):
|
# activate when https://bugzilla.gnome.org/show_bug.cgi?id=684558
|
||||||
|
# is resolved
|
||||||
|
if False and (Gtk.get_major_version(), Gtk.get_minor_version()) >= (3,8):
|
||||||
self.model.reverse_order()
|
self.model.reverse_order()
|
||||||
else:
|
else:
|
||||||
## GTK 3.6 rows_reordered not exposed by gi, we need to reconnect
|
## GTK 3.6 rows_reordered not exposed by gi, we need to reconnect
|
||||||
|
|||||||
@@ -723,7 +723,9 @@ class TreeBaseModel(GObject.Object, Gtk.TreeModel):
|
|||||||
else:
|
else:
|
||||||
iternode = self.get_iter(node)
|
iternode = self.get_iter(node)
|
||||||
path = self.do_get_path(iternode)
|
path = self.do_get_path(iternode)
|
||||||
if self.GTK38PLUS:
|
# activate when https://bugzilla.gnome.org/show_bug.cgi?id=684558
|
||||||
|
# is resolved
|
||||||
|
if False and self.GTK38PLUS:
|
||||||
##rows_reordered is only exposed in gi starting GTK 3.8
|
##rows_reordered is only exposed in gi starting GTK 3.8
|
||||||
self.rows_reordered(path, iter, rows)
|
self.rows_reordered(path, iter, rows)
|
||||||
if self.nrgroups > 1:
|
if self.nrgroups > 1:
|
||||||
|
|||||||
Reference in New Issue
Block a user